Skip to content

Conversation

@samvaity
Copy link
Member

  • Add typespec-new-project skill with SKILL.md and references
  • Add Skills decision framework (when to use Skills vs MCP Tools)
  • Add test infrastructure:
    • check-skill-tokens.ps1: Validates token budget
    • test-skill-triggers.ps1: Tests skill discoverability via embeddings
    • prompts.json template for trigger phrase testing
  • Update TspInitTool.cs with improved description (Skill-inspired)
  • Add additional test prompts for typespec_init_project

Results:

  • Skill triggers: 8/8 passed (100%)
  • MCP tool discoverability improved from 33% to 100% with better description

- Add typespec-new-project skill with SKILL.md and references
- Add Skills decision framework (when to use Skills vs MCP Tools)
- Add test infrastructure:
  - check-skill-tokens.ps1: Validates token budget
  - test-skill-triggers.ps1: Tests skill discoverability via embeddings
  - prompts.json template for trigger phrase testing
- Update TspInitTool.cs with improved description (Skill-inspired)
- Add additional test prompts for typespec_init_project

Results:
- Skill triggers: 8/8 passed (100%)
- MCP tool discoverability improved from 33% to 100% with better description
@github-actions github-actions bot added the azsdk-cli Issues related to Azure/azure-sdk-tools::tools/azsdk-cli label Jan 31,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

azsdk-cli Issues related to Azure/azure-sdk-tools::tools/azsdk-cli

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ants